California generally gives you two years from a crash to file suit, but that window can shrink to as little as six months if a government entity, like a city road crew or public agency, is involved. Acting sooner protects your options if a public entity had any role in the crash.
Under California's pure comparative fault rule, an insurer will try to pin part of the blame on you to reduce what they owe, even if you're mostly not at fault. An attorney can push back on that math before it becomes the final word on your claim.
